Lean Focus LLC
Chief Financial Officer
POSITION:
Chief Financial Officer (CFO)
LOCATION/TRAVEL:
Toledo, OH area
REPORTS TO:
President and CEO
TRAVEL:
Up to 15% domestic
POSITION SUMMARY:
Our client is seeking a Chief Financial Officer to join their machining business in the Toledo area! The right candidate will be a data-driven thought partner who works cross-functionally to help teams dive deeper into their financials. The CFO will be a key player in transforming the organization into a market-leading platform in precision components manufacturing. Backed by a robust commercial and operational strategy, our client is targeting $60M in revenue and 25%+ EBITDA within three years
JOB RESPONSIBILITIES:
Develop and execute forward-looking financial strategy to support business transformation and scale revenue from $32M to $60M. Drive EBITDA margins to 25%+ through disciplined financial management, pricing optimization, and cost efficiency. Partner with President to align capital allocation with strategic priorities, including CapEx, automation, and Lean. Build data-driven FP&A framework to enable proactive decision-making. Develop and maintain robust forecasting, budgeting, and financial modeling tools. Monitor key metrics:
Revenue Growth Rate EBITDA Margin Operating Expense Ratio ( Working Capital Efficiency (DSO, DPO, Inventory Turns) Capex ROI
Maintain strong liquidity to support operational growth, M&A, and facility investments. Optimize working capital via strategic inventory, receivables, and payables management. Lead CapEx planning to align with business scalability. Lead cost reduction and margin expansion with operations and supply chain. Optimize product and customer-level profitability through dynamic pricing. Identify and drive margin expansion in core verticals: medical, aerospace, automation. Lead financial due diligence and modeling for strategic acquisitions targeting $5M EBITDA. Ensure seamless post-merger financial integration: systems, reporting, and cost structures. Capture synergies across acquired platforms to drive value creation. Uphold financial integrity with strong controls, accurate reporting, and audit readiness. Ensure compliance with regulatory, tax, and investor requirements. Lead enterprise risk management focused on market volatility, supply chain, and financial exposures. EDUCATION AND EXPERIENCE:
Bachelor's degree in finance, accounting, economics, or a related field. MBA with a focus on finance or accounting is preferred. 10+ years of progressive financial leadership, with at least 5 years as a CFO, VP of Finance, or equivalent in a manufacturing or industrial business. Proven experience scaling a mid-market company (preferably private equity-backed) to $50M+ in revenue. Deep expertise in FP&A, cost accounting, working capital management, and M&A execution and a demonstrated ability to build FP&A discipline, processes, and teams from the ground up. Familiarity with Lean manufacturing environments, ERP systems, and financial reporting standards. Continuous Improvement (CI) Expertise with a proven track record of driving continuous improvement in top-tier business systems. Track record of achieving measurable improvements in gross margin, operating expenses rationalization, and working capital reduction. Extensive experience managing multiple acquisitions from diligence through integration. Professional certifications like CPA or CFA are highly valued.
